The Company now advises that on 11 June 2024 the Supreme Court of Sweden (“Supreme Court”) delivered its ruling regarding the Company’s application for leave to appeal the decision by the Land and Environment Court of Appeal delivered on the 14 March 2023.The Supreme Court did not grant leave to appeal. No reason was given for this determination.The Company is naturally disappointed by the Supreme Court’s decision. The Company had proposed solutions to the issues raised in the Land and Environment Court decision as part of the appeal process but the Supreme Court made no comment on these proposed solutions.
